The fourth trimester, as we may like to call it, is a huge transition especially for first time mums. We can often feel unsupported and as though we should be able to do it all on our own. 

We have somehow lost that “village approach” to parenting where we once had our larger community supporting and looking after the new family. Back then, a child was raised by the village as opposed to our modern day approach where we are settled into much smaller family units and take on the load alone.

    As a Postpartum Doula I will come into your home and nurture you as the mother. When I arrive, we'll sit down and chat over a cup of tea and check in with how everything is going and where you may need extra support over the session. I can then jump into whipping up some essential breastfeeding snacks or maybe putting on dinner for the family. I am also able to watch over baby whilst you take a long bath or even get a bit of shut eye.

    Perhaps I will get through a load or two of laundry, then when you are feeling fresh again we can go through any other areas you may need some guidance in. Belly binding or a sitz bath may feel beneficial in the early days. Our session will hopefully leave you feeling revived and with a bit more energy than when I arrived.

    My goal is to care for you as the mother and support the whole family through this transition, being able to provide a familiar face in the household that you can lean on and trust for support.
